Switching students between Windows, MacOS, and Chrome platforms carries unquantified costs in lost productivity and learning time. A proposed move of 25,000 students to MacBook Neos raises questions about educational ROI and payback periods. Minecraft's UI, used in over 40,000 school systems, adds another layer of complexity.
